Chicago Sun-Times
I think Michael Bay sometimes sucks but I find it possible to love him for a movie like "Transformers." It's goofy fun with a lot of stuff that blows up real good, and it has the grace not only to realize how preposterous it is, but to make that into an asset.
Roger Ebert

USA Today
Yes, it's loud, explosive and silly, but it also perfectly embodies the concept of a summer blockbuster with its simple good-guys-vs.-bad-guys plot, cheeky humor and flawless special effects. Transformers, opening tonight in many theaters, is easily the best movie based on an adaptation of a cartoon TV series.
Claudia Puig
